About the Role
Backcountry is looking to deepen its brand presence through strategic partnerships and media relations, and this role is central to making that happen. As Brand Marketing - Partnerships & PR Specialist, you will execute partnership programs and PR initiatives that drive brand awareness, storytelling, and authentic connection with core outdoor audiences.
In your first 6–12 months, success means establishing a reliable cadence of media outreach and partner activations, building strong relationships with key media contacts and industry partners, and delivering measurable improvements in press coverage and brand visibility.
This is a lean team. You will own a lot, move fast, and make decisions with full end-to-end responsibility.
What You'll Do
Identify, coordinate, and manage collaborations with brands, athletes, and industry partners to execute Backcountry's partnership strategy.
Develop and implement PR initiatives that enhance brand visibility through media outreach, press efforts, and storytelling.
Draft and coordinate press materials, announcements, and proactive media outreach efforts.
Build and maintain relationships with media contacts, influencers, and key stakeholders to generate authentic engagement and positive coverage.
Partner with brand, content, and performance marketing teams to support integrated campaigns that include PR and partnership components.
Research industry trends and competitor activity to identify new partnership and positioning opportunities.
Support crisis communications efforts and reputation management initiatives as needed.
Track and report on PR and partnership performance metrics, providing insights and recommendations to internal stakeholders.
